Harder than I imagined!
Wow, this is harder than I imagined.
Thank you all for the suggestions. I have called 11 jewelry stores/goldsmiths etc so far and not a single one sells anything remotely similar to what I thought would be an "easy to find in the towns surrounding the lake" item. I am not giving up on finding someone who sells one but it's looking bleak and more like a custom piece might have to be made. The problem with that is the cost would be more than double what a typical gold charm would cost (that in itself is already rediculous) and it definitely wouldn't be done for Christmas. I'm thinking that I should have a dozen made and sell them myself but evidently there is not much of a demand for them! Hard to believe...
